The 6x01 EVM is tricky to install. In some PCs it wont work at all . If you
contact TI support they have a documment that gives some hints.
Also the EVM have problems with certain 3com ethernet cards and some graphic
cards. If possible try a different PC.

Check your BIOS settings, especially the "Plug and Play OS" one. Try _both_
settings (yes and no). Win98 is supposed to be a plug and play os and hence
"yes" should be appropriate but I recently installed a EVM card in a PC with
win2000 and it wouldnt work unless I set plug and play os : no.

The driver for the EVM card is very old and I belive it has PCI compatibilty
issues.
